Gary was born on June 1, 1936 in Manitowoc. He was the son of the late Daniel and Florence (Albrecht) Krumel. Gary attended Lincoln High School and graduated with the class of 1954. He served his country with the United States Navy from 1955 until his honorable discharge in 1957. On May 3, 1958 he married Joan D. Ewald in Manitowoc.
Gary had been employed for 36 years with the Manitowoc County Highway Department retiring in 1990. He was a member of First Reformed United Church of Christ, lifetime member of the Manitowoc Gun Club and Wildlife Forever and the Manitowoc County Fair. Gary enjoyed playing cards, traveling, was an avid hunter and fisherman, and spending time with family was always at the top of his list. In 1992 Gary was the recipient of a heart-transplant.
He is survived by his wife of 59 years: Joan; his children: Robert Krumel, Alaska; Kim (Terry) Thiel, Howards Grove; Dale (Patti Ann) Krumel, Florida; grandson: Jayme Thiel; granddaughter: Kara Thiel; sister: Lavange Wilda, Florida; two brothers: Wayne Krumel, Florida; Dick (Maureen) Krumel, Manitowoc; brothers-in-law and sisters-in-law: Judy Beck, Jim Ewald and special friend Kathy Wanish, Joan Ewald, Vivian Krumel Storey; along with many special relatives and friends. He was preceded in death by his parents: Daniel and Florence Krumel; brother: Dan Krumel; two brothers-in-law: Richard Wicihowski and Don Ewald; and one sister-in-law: Sheila Ewald. Memorial services will be held 11 a.m. on Tuesday, May 2, 2017 at the Harrigan Parkside Funeral Home. Officiating will be Rev. Judine Duerwachter with entombment of his cremated remains at Knollwood Mausoleum at a later date. Cremation has taken place at the Harrigan Parkside Crematory and Chapel.
